Definition

Direct regulatory or substrate relationships by which specific nutrients (e.g., glucose, amino acids, fatty acids, vitamins, minerals) alter the activity, flux or regulation of cellular metabolic pathways and thereby influence energy homeostasis, biosynthetic output, and cellular signalling.
